Abstract

For design purposes, we use stochastic modeling and sensitivity analysis to identify the most important parameters of the AC power distribution in the integrated power system (IPS) model. The main AC subsystem of the IPS consists of a 59 kW synchronous generator and a motor drive of 50 hp induction motor. First, we perform sensitivity analysis treating all 31 parameters of the full model as stochastic variables. Second, we construct two low-dimensional stochastic models (with 15 and 8 parameters) and compare the multi-rate dynamics of the reduced models to the full model. For parameter variations larger than 50%, the low-dimensional models still predict accurately the mean values but underpredict the variance of most state variables.
